HEBRON, March 5, 2026 (WAFA) – Several Palestinians on Thursday were injured, including one by live fire, and a young woman was detained during Israeli military raids on several areas in the Hebron governorate.
According to WAFA correspondent, Israeli troops opened gunfire on a vehicle carrying several Palestinians during a raid on the town of Tarqumiya, northwest of Hebron, wounding a young man in the hand. He was later rushed to a nearby hospital for treatment.
In the meantime, several other Palestinians, including a woman, were injured when Israeli forces severely beat multiple families after raiding their homes in the al-Fawwar refugee camp, south of Hebron, and in the Jaber and al-Salaymeh neighborhoods of the closed area of Hebron city.
Israeli forces also raided the towns of Sa'ir and al-Shuyukh, northeast of Hebron, and arrested 24-year-old Shaima Musa al-Halayqa after raiding her family's home, searching it, and ransacking its contents.
